When trying to install Windows 7 from a burnt DVD (verified when it was burnt), the system will just hang at the "Starting Windows Setup" or whatever it is after it asks if you want to install windows or repair your system. It just sits there. I get the 3-sec interval HDD light, and no activity from the DVD drive. Any ideas?

I've got a Q9450, GB P35-DS3L and 6GB of RAM (everything is at stock speeds).
 
A buddy of mine has had the same issue with every build on Windows 7 using a GB S3 motherboard (965). Updated BIOS, etc. No matter what he cannot get Window 7 to install and the same thing happens you report.

Wish I knew... maybe someone else will have a fix.
 
Try with one stick of RAM in. Burn the DVD again. Install from a USB stick. In that order.
